PHp表单下拉单选框,POSCMS 复选框 单选框 下拉框 字段的输出方法

复选框 单选框 下拉框三个字段有点意思,都有自己的属性名称和选择值,一般数据库储存的是选择值,通常在显示的时候需要输出属性的名称,而不是值,那么我们就要通过反查询值来实现。

714bb208f43ec974c0f39d6ca5bc32c1.png

借花献佛拿来一张图,类似这种定义方式,其实这种属性值的定义方式是错误的,后者要设置为数字才对,应该纠正为:

本部分内容设定了隐藏,需要回复后才能看到,立即回复

因为名称也是字符,值也是字符,那么就失去了值的意义,那为什么你还去设置一个值。

要么不要值,要么设置数字。

言归正传,来设置输出方法

1、单选和下拉选择字段

内容页show.html

本部分内容设定了隐藏,需要回复后才能看到,立即回复

列表页list.html

本部分内容设定了隐藏,需要回复后才能看到,立即回复

2、复选框

内容页show.html//将id=222字段的下拉框值读出来

{php $field = dr_field_options_id(222);}

// 遍历全部

{loop $field $value $name}

{if in_array($value, $字段英文名称)}

选项名称:{$name}

选项值:{$value}

{/if}

{/loop}

列表页list.html//将id=222字段的下拉框值读出来

{php $field = dr_field_options_id(222);}

// 遍历全部

{loop $field $value $name}

{if in_array($value, $t.字段英文名称)}

选项名称:{$name}

选项值:{$value}

{/if}

{/loop}


本文来自互联网用户投稿,文章观点仅代表作者本人,不代表本站立场,不承担相关法律责任。如若转载,请注明出处。 如若内容造成侵权/违法违规/事实不符,请点击【内容举报】进行投诉反馈!

相关文章

立即
投稿

微信公众账号

微信扫一扫加关注

返回
顶部